Crime overview

Great Stone Road area has the 3rd highest crime rate of 124 local areas in Allens Cross , and the 113th highest crime rate of 3,059 local areas in Birmingham .

This postcode sits in a local crime hotspot. Overall crime levels here are significantly higher than in the surrounding streets and the wider area.

The overall crime rate in the area around Great Stone Road (B31 2LT) in the last 12 months was 436.9 per 1,000 residents and was 327.1% higher than the Allens Cross average (102.3 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, this area’s most reported crimes were Shoplifting with 45 offences recorded. The least common crime was Possession of weapons with 1 case , down -50.0% compared to 2025. The fastest-growing crime category was Burglary ( 100.0% YoY). The sharpest decline was Anti-social behaviour ( -50.0% YoY).

Violent crimes totalled 53 (≈ 180.9 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were rising ( 8.2%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has rising ( 202.9% comparing early vs recent averages) .

In the area around Great Stone Road (B31 2LT), the main crime hotspot is near Parking Area. Police recorded 188 crimes here, including 85 violent or public-order offences. All these locations are within roughly 0.3 miles.
